A Laughing Dove perching then vomiting. The Laughing Dove (Spilopelia senegalensis) is widespread throughout Africa, the Middle East and the Indian subcontinent. The species was introduced to Perth in 1889 and is now found from about Shark Bay in the north, east to Kalgoorlie and south to Esperance. Laughing Doves are sedentary, and are mostly associated with human habitation, and do not seem to invade native bushland.
